Job description

Position Summary:

The Quality Inspector is responsible for the overall quality of the boat. This person ensures that all options and functions are checked and operate correctly along with ensuring the boat meets the cosmetic criteria and regulatory standards.

Responsibilities /Duties/Functions /Tasks:

  • Perform the inspection required at the specific checkpoint and enter results in the data collection software.
  • Must have the ability to be cross trained in all inspection points which may include but are not limited to:
    • Vital to Quality (safety) verification
    • Regulatory verification
    • Functional verification
    • Cosmetic verification
    • Ensure all options in boat
    • On-the-water function and performance verification
  • Must be able to provide audits in all areas to support improvement activities
  • Must be team oriented, able to interact positively, and contribute to positive morale in the department.
  • Must possess the ability to effectively communicate verbally and in writing.
  • Maintain a clean and organized workplace.
  • Report to work on time and stay in good standings with Maverick’s attendance policy.
  • All duties must be performed in accordance with Maverick’s safety policies and procedures.
  • Other duties may be assigned. 

Qualifications:

  • High School Diploma or GED
  • 2 years of manufacturing experience
  • Basic computer skills are required

Physical Demands:

  • Bending, kneeling (squatting), lifting, and twisting continuously throughout the day.
  • Being able to stand/walk for up to or if not longer 8 hours each day.
